Clash连接不上网络的解决方案详解

在现代互联网生活中,Clash 作为一款优秀的代理工具,广泛应用于提高用户的上网体验。然而,有时用户可能会遇到Clash连接不上网络的问题,这会给用户的使用带来不便。本文将为您详细分析此问题的原因及解决方案,同时提供常见问答,帮助用户排除故障。

了解Clash

Clash 是一款支持多个协议的网络代理工具,并被用于科学上网。它可以帮助用户在网络不稳定或被封锁的情况下,安全访问互联网内容。

Clash连接不上网络的原因

  1. 配置错误:如果 Clash 的配置文件(如config.yaml)出现错误,可能导致无法连接网络。
  2. 网络问题:本地网络不稳定或ISP(互联网服务提供商)的限制也会影响连接。
  3. 防火墙设置:操作系统或第三方防火墙可能会阻止 Clash 访问网络。
  4. 服务器问题:所使用的代理服务器网络不稳定,可能导致连接中断。
  5. 版本问题:使用过时或不兼容的版本也可能引起连接问题。
  6. DNS故障:域名解析失败可能导致无法访问目标网站。

Clash连接不上网络的解决步骤

以下是一些有效的解决 Clash连接不上网络 的方法:

1. 检查配置文件

  • 确保 Clash 的配置文件无误,遵循合适的格式确保**{“port”:”,”type”:**等关键字段填入正确。
  • 你可以尝试导入一个被证实能够正常工作时的配置文件,帮助识别问题的原因。

2. 检查网络连接

  • 确认你的设备是否连接到了互联网,可以尝试在几个网站之间进行访问检查。
  • 可以通过更换网络环境,如使用另一种网络或重启路由器,以排除网络问题。

3. 配置防火墙

  • 查看操作系统的防火墙设置,确保 Clash 被允许访问网络。
  • 默许 Clash 程序在防火墙中放行,以避免直接拒绝访问。

4. 验证代理服务器

  • 检查当前代理的可用性,尝试使用其他代理服务器测试连接是否正常。
  • 如果存在多个代理,局部服务不可用的情况也要尤为注意。

5. 更新软件版本

  • 确保在使用最新版的 Clash,向其主页或源代码仓库进行更新检查。
  • 因为新版本可能修复了旧版中的bug和性能问题。

6. 处理DNS问题

  • 使用公共DNS如:8.8.8.81.1.1.1,在本地设备的网络设置中进行调整看看是否能解决问题。
  • 互联网供应商 teir 1, teir 2 的DNS结构有时时间请求并非及时,根据DNS方式的使用转换来进行实验。

常见问题解答

1. 如何确认Clash是否安装成功?

可以通过以下方式检查 Clash 是否成功安装:

  • 打开终端,输入clash -v,能够看到 Clash 的版本信息。
  • 若提示command not found,则说明未正确安装。

2. 有没有特定的操作系统支持?

Clash 支持各类操作系统,包括 Windows、macOS 和 Linux,用户根据不同类型的环境可适用于下载符合版本文件。

3. 换了网络后,Clash还要重新配置吗?

通常情况下,如果保持同一代理服务器,网络更换后无需重新配置。但若NET-DNS更改、规则有变动、使用不同的网卡则要再次检查配置。

4. 在使用Clash时发生连接重置怎么办?

若连接重置,请逐步排查:

  • 密钥是否输入匹配且也是串通的。
  • 代理没有别的协议重置情况造成影响。

结论

在使用 Clash 时,连接不上网络 的情况虽不常见,但却也不是无解。希望通过本文详细解析和常见问答,能够为广大用户解决这一问题,并稳定使用 Clash 所带来的便利和安全上网体验。如果问题依旧存在,您不妨求助于技术支持寻求更进一步的帮助。

正文完
 0